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1.5 lbs)
  • 1 lb baby potatoes, halved
  • 2 fresh lemons, juiced
  • 4 garlic cloves, minced
  • 2 tsp dried oregano
  • 3 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h parsley for garnish

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and prepare a baking sheet with nonstick spray.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, minced garlic, dried oregano, salt, and pepper.
  3. Add chicken breasts and halved baby potatoes to the marinade; toss until well coated.
  4. Arrange chicken in the center of the prepared baking sheet with potatoes scattered around.
  5. Bake for 30-35 minutes until chicken re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(75°C).
  6. Allow resting for 5 minutes before garnishing with parsley and serving with lemon wedges.
